Gallery: Parents tearfully send off new students at Goodbye Blessing

August 17, 2021 by Sydney Varner

Families of new students gathered in Wildcat Stadium for the annual Goodbye Blessing Tuesday evening. University President Phil Schubert spoke encouraging words over the class of 2025 while Associate Professor Rachel Riley spoke about her faith in the students’ journey moving forward.

Families and students walk out of Wildcat Stadium to share dinner together after Goodbye Blessing. (Photo by Sydney Varner)
Families and students walk out together after Goodbye Blessing. (Photo by Sydney Varner)
Families hug their students after the Goodbye Blessing. (Photo by Sydney Varner)

Families catch up with each other in Wildcat Stadium after Goodbye Blessing. (Photo by Sydney Varner)
Families hug their students after Goodbye Blessing. (Photo by Sydney Varner)
Incoming freshman and their families sing ‘The Lord Bless You and Keep You,’ an ACU tradition, to close the Goodbye Blessing. (Photo by Sydney Varner)

Wildcat Week director Caddie Coupe, assistant director Lauren Gumm and student directors sing ‘The Lord Bless You and Keep You.’ (Photo by Sydney Varner)
Families place hands on their students as a blessing is read over them and their time at ACU. (Photo by Sydney Varner)
Families place hands on their incoming students as a blessing is read over them. (Photo by Sydney Varner)

Associate Professor Rachel Riley speaks to the incoming class of 2025 about faith. (Photo by Sydney Varner)
University President Phil Schubert speaks encouraging words over the incoming class and their families during Goodbye Blessing. (Photo by Sydney Varner)
Incoming freshmen and their families gather in Wildcat Stadium for Goodbye Blessing. (Photo by Sydney Varner)
